Maintenance Performance Review
Why Maintenance Performance Review?
Reveal Hidden Inefficiencies
- Many companies don’t know how much reactive work, poor planning, or spare parts waste is driving costs
- A review uncovers where money and time are being lost
Benchmark Against Industry Best Practices
- Without benchmarks, it’s impossible to know if performance is good or lagging
- Reviews compare KPIs (MTBF, MTTR, planned vs. reactive ratio) against industry standards.
Enable Data-Driven Decision-Making
- Maintenance is frequently based on intuition rather than concrete data
- A review provides hard data and insights to guide investments, staffing, and technology choices
Prepare for Digitalization & Predictive Maintenance
- Before adopting CMMS/EAM, IoT, or AI, companies need to know their starting point
- Reviews identify digital readiness and help build the right roadmap
Align Maintenance with Business Goals
- Maintenance should not just “fix machines” but enable uptime, safety, quality, and cost efficiency
- A review ensures maintenance is positioned as a strategic contributor to business success
The Key Aspects
KPI & Performance Analysis
- Review core maintenance KPIs such as MTBF, MTTR, % planned vs. unplanned work, backlog levels, and spare part
- Compare results with industry benchmarks
Process & Workflow Assessment
- Evaluate how work orders, scheduling, preventive maintenance, and spare part management are handled
- Identify bottlenecks, inefficiencies, and over-reliance on reactive work
Technology & System Utilization
- Assess current use of CMMS/EAM tools
- Check data quality, integration with ERP/production systems, and reporting capabilities
Asset & Resource Management
- Analyze asset criticality and lifecycle management
- Review manpower allocation, contractor use, and training levels
Organization, Culture & Skills
- Understand maintenance team structure, skill levels, and knowledge transfer practices
- Assess communication and alignment with operations, safety, and production teams
Compliance, Safety & Sustainability
- Verify adherence to regulations, safety standards, and environmental policies
- Review how maintenance contributes to ESG and energy-efficiency goals
Gap Identification & Opportunity Mapping
- Highlight inefficiencies, risks, and improvement opportunities
- Prioritize quick wins versus long-term transformation needs

Maintenance Transformation
Why Maintenance Transformation?
Too Much Reactive Work, Not Enough Prevention
Unplanned downtime is costly and disruptive.
Customers seek transformation to shift from reactive firefighting to predictive, condition-based strategies that reduce failures and extend asset life.
Outdated Tools & Siloed Systems
Many companies still rely on spreadsheets or legacy systems that lack visibility and scalability.
Transformation enables the move to modern CMMS/EAM, IoT integration, and data-driven planning.
Need to Align with Digital Strategy
Maintenance is a core pillar of digital transformation and Industry 4.0 initiatives.
Customers want to align maintenance with broader goals like smart factories, connected assets, and AI-driven decisions.
Rising Operational & Sustainability Pressures
Energy use, parts waste, and over-maintenance increase costs and carbon footprint.
Transformation helps optimize resource use, support ESG goals, and meet regulatory standards.
Talent Shortages and Knowledge Gaps
Aging workforces and skill gaps threaten reliability.
Transformation includes standardizing knowledge, enabling remote diagnostics, and upskilling teams with digital tools.
The Key Aspects
Strategic Alignment
- Link maintenance goals with business priorities: uptime, cost reduction, sustainability, and customer satisfaction
- Move maintenance from a cost center to a value enabler
Asset Strategy & Criticality Management
- Apply Reliability-Centered Maintenance (RCM) and risk-based approaches
- Prioritize critical assets and tailor strategies (run-to-fail, preventive, predictive)
Process Redesign & Standardization
Streamlined operations with lean processes and automation
Better alignment between people, tools, and service goals
Digital Enablement & Data Utilization
- Implement CMMS/EAM systems, IoT sensors, predictive analytics, and AI
- Ensure data quality, real-time visibility, and integration with ERP/production
Workforce & Skills Development
- Upskill technicians in digital tools, condition monitoring, and reliability methods
- Build a culture of proactive maintenance and cross-functional collaboration
Change Management & Adoption
- Drive buy-in from leadership to shop floor
- Use communication, training, and quick wins to ensure cultural adoption
Continuous Improvement & KPI Tracking
- Establish dashboards and governance to measure results (MTBF, MTTR, planned vs. reactive ratio).
- Create a feedback loop for ongoing optimization and scaling.
